Menu

Post image 1
Post image 2
1 / 2
0

API Versioning Strategies: REST vs GraphQL Approaches

DEV Community·丁久·20 days ago
#LssVYhmG
#api#technology#devops#cloud#versioning#rest
Reading 0:00
15s threshold

This article was originally published on AI Study Room . For the full version with working code examples and related articles, visit the original post. API Versioning Strategies: REST vs GraphQL Approaches API Versioning Strategies: REST vs GraphQL Approaches API Versioning Strategies: REST vs GraphQL Approaches API Versioning Strategies: REST vs GraphQL Approaches API Versioning Strategies: REST vs GraphQL Approaches API Versioning Strategies: REST vs GraphQL Approaches API Versioning Strategies: REST vs GraphQL Approaches API versioning manages changes to public interfaces without breaking existing clients. REST and GraphQL handle versioning differently due to their architectural differences. REST Versioning URL versioning embeds the version in the path: /v1/users, /v2/users. It is the most common approach. Simple to implement and discoverable. It encourages maintaining multiple API versions simultaneously. Header versioning uses custom headers: Accept: application/vnd.api+json;version=2. Keeps URLs clean.…

Continue reading — create a free account

Join HashtagPLUS to read full articles, follow hashtags, vote, and join the conversation.

Read More